The Bloc Quebecois is putting pressure on the Liberal government to increase old age security payments for Canadians under 75, a move that could prove politically challenging for Prime Minister Justin Trudeau. The Bloc has threatened to bring down the minority Liberal government if its private member's bill isn't supported.
